JSON - c和cJSON哪种更好?

此外,cJSON库提供了更灵活的字符串输出选项,支持格式化与无格式两种输出方式,而JSON-c库则仅限于单一的字符串转化,且缺乏格式控制,限制了应用场景的多样性和复杂性。...


linux 下c程序哪一个json库比较好用

总的来说,cJSON是一个功能强大、易于使用的JSON解析库,在Linux环境下,推荐开发者优先考虑使用。


C 语言项目如何给 json 增加值?

一 使用cJSON_AddItemToObject函数增加一个子节点 cJSON*root=cJSON_Parse(json_string);cJSON_AddItemToObject(root,"new_key",cJSON_Create...


cjson cJSON - GetObjectItem - 前端 - CSDN问答

cJSON *root = cJSON_Parse(json_string); // json_string 是包含 JSON 数据的字符串 if (root == NULL) { // 解析错误,处理错误信...


cJSON 学习(1)JSON的存储与构建

JSON 是一种易于人阅读和机器解析的轻量级数据交换格式。cJSON,一个符合 ANSI C 标准的轻量级 JSON 解析器,因其易于理解的程序而被推荐学习。JSON 中的每一个值对应一...


Cocos2d - x lua 启用cjson - 百度经验

1 将cjson加入libluacocos2d中,并进行编译,否则导入失败;2 修改lua_extensions.c// cjson#include "cjson/lua_cjson.h"static luaL_Reg luax_exts[] = {{"socket.core",...


【ESP32开发】解析JSON,这里用cJSON

cJSON是C语言领域中的一款超轻量级JSON解析库。它开源于GitHub,遵循MIT协议,对使用友好。与Python的json库、Java的Gson、jackson、fastjson等解析器类似,cJSON同样能解析...


cJSON源码学习笔记

printbuffer结构体包含输出缓冲区的起始地址、大小和偏置。cJSON_CreateIntArray、cJSON_CreateFloatArray和cJSON_CreateDoubleArray函数创建整数、浮点数和双精度数组。cJSON_...


如何进行json与c语言项目的数据转换?

在C语言项目中,通过使用现成的JSON库,如cJSON,可以实现JSON数据与C语言数据类型的高效转换。以下是使用cJSON库进行转换的示例程序。程序首先通过cJSON_Parse函数解析JSON...


C 语言编程中的 JSON 数据怎么读取?

cJSON是一款轻量级的C语言JSON解析器,它可以将JSON格式的数据解析成C语言中的数据结构,也可以将C语言中的数据结构序列化成JSON格式的数据。c...


相关搜索

热门搜索